As the Colorado General Assembly nears completion of the state budget there is little doubt that the decisions they make will impact Colorado’s economy for years to come. Known by insiders as the “long bill,” the state budget has passed the State House and is currently being debated by the State Senate.

Proposition CC asks voters if they want to allow the state to retain and spend all revenue above the current TABOR spending limit.
